7 Stocks you need to know for Tuesday

Synnex (SNX | charts | news | PowerRating) beat earnings expectations on Monday afternoon, announcing $0.46 EPS over an expected $0.44 EPS.

Kroger (KR | charts | news | PowerRating) is expected to report $0.48 EPS on Tuesday before the opening bell.

When Lennar (LEN | charts | news | PowerRating) announces quarterly earnings tomorrow morning, watch for $0.01 EPS.

Analysts are watching for Steelcase (SCS | charts | news | PowerRating) to announce $0.19 EPS before the bell on Tuesday.

Nike (NKE | charts | news | PowerRating), H.B. Fuller (FUL | charts | news | PowerRating) and Oracle (ORCL | charts | news | PowerRating) all report earnings on Tuesday after the market closes, so watch for heightened price action and volatility ahead of the bell.
